What to check before for good cause buildings with rent-stabilized apartments in North Corona

  • Expect tenant protections under the good cause laws, which limit certain rent increases and non-renewals.
  • Verify building compliance with rent-stabilization regulations before signing any lease.
  • Review Openigloo's building data for insights on tenant history and potential issues.
  • Confirm fees and costs beyond rent, including utilities and potential broker fees that may apply.
  • Check the pet policy if you plan to move with a pet, as it can vary by building.
